Women's admission at Dr Rafiq Zakaria College for Women for 2026: eligibility is 10+2 in the relevant stream. Minimum qualifying marks at Dr Rafiq Zakaria College for Women: 40% for BA, 45% for BSc (Science mandatory), 40% for BCom, 45% for BCA (Maths required in 12th). All seats are reserved for women. For UPSC civil services examination eligibility, the requirement is any degree from a recognised university — a criterion this affiliated degree satisfies. The institution's ranking and fee level are irrelevant to UPSC eligibility; the university's recognition status is the only relevant credential check.
